Hi I'm working on a intern project for an electrical switch/socket manufacturer.

They had requested me to create a machine that will be able to check the connectivity of all 3 terminals of a standard 5A socket. Along with the ability to apply a high voltage of 2000V along the live terminal when the switch is in it's open position for only 2 seconds. If there is current passing (due to the high voltage) a buzzer should ring alerting the operator.

At the same time, the time needed to check a product should be from 5-6 seconds and a counter should log the number of sockets checked out.

I would really appreciate any ideas for this project. I have designed a basic circuit for use but i"m unsure on how i could use contactors/relays to isolate the buzzer from the 2000V high voltage
